BlackEarth Minerals Adds Leading Australian Businesswoman To Board

selective focus of man and woman shaking hands at office

BlackEarth Minerals NL (ASX:BEM) has named experienced and leading Australian Business Advisor, Heather Zampatti, to the Board of the company.

Perth based Ms Zampatti is currently head of wealth management at Bell Potter Securities and sits on the boards of the Federal Government Remuneration Tribunal, Osteoporosis Australia, The University of WA Club, Theatre 180, Tura New Music and ASIC’s Financial Services Consultative Committee.

She is also a former member of the Australian Federal Government’s Takeover Panel, Financial Sector Advisory Council ,Chair of Lotterywest, Chair of Princess Margaret Hospital Foundation and Board member of Healthways, AIM WA, Chief Executive Women (CEW) and WA Ballet.

Ms Zampatti holds a Bachelor of Science from UWA, a Diploma of Education and is a Certified Financial Planner and is a Master of Stockbroking (MSAA). Heather has also recently been awarded an honourary Doctor of Commerce from Edith Cowan University (ECU).

‘The Board are delighted to have someone of Heather’s experience and wealth of business knowledge join our Board. Not only does she bring to the Board extensive experience in developing strategies to grow and expand enterprises, Heather has a track record of providing senior leadership skills in dealing with a range of industries and government bodies,” BlackEarth Chairman, George Bauk, said.

“Her extensive experience with social causes and governance functions will add enormous value to our Board as we continue to expand our operations and networks globally”

MsZampatti commented : “I am delighted to be joining the Board of BlackEarth. Having worked in Capital Markets, Stockbroking and the Investment Sector for over 35 years, I am keen to contribute to the ongoing success of the company.

“BlackEarth is at an exciting stage in its development towards becoming a leading producer of concentrate from its Maniry Project, expandable graphite and other down stream graphite products which is finding rising demand in areas including electric vehicles and clean energy delivery.

“The company’s highly experienced and respected team have the skills and knowledge to deliver a world class graphite Company. I am excited to assist BlackEarth in its development, market recognition and deliver shareholder value.”
